What seats fit polo?

Post by randy »

Just wondering what front seats will fit in polo. Need to replace drivers side but just thought i might consider going for a pair of leathers.

Any seats that are easy to fit or what is required to fit them?

People give a straight answer to the lad here!!

A couple of the answers i could turn around and say any seat will fit with the right mods......yesTT seats will fit with modifications, but then so will R32 seats, RS4 seats......bloody ferrari seats.

The only ones i really know of that will drop straight in are mk3 golfs and seat ibiza's
